Summary

Are you an experienced communications professional ready to take the lead in a fast-paced, creative, and purpose-driven environment?

We're looking for a talented Communications Team Leader to join our friendly and ambitious team for a fixed-term period of two years.

This is a fantastic opportunity to shape and deliver strategic communications that support our corporate priorities and strengthen the council's public profile. From managing high-profile campaigns to leading a small but dedicated team, no two days are the same.

What you'll be doing:
Leading and coordinating a busy communications team delivering proactive PR, internal communications, events, and digital content.
Managing communications projects that support the council's Corporate Plan, major events, and service transformation.
Acting as a key advisor to senior officers and elected members on media handling and communications strategy.
Leading our response to media enquiries and supporting the council's reputation through thoughtful and timely PR.
Planning and delivering engaging, multi-channel campaigns that speak directly to our communities.
What we're looking for:
A communications or PR professional with significant experience in a similar role, ideally within a complex or public sector setting.
A confident leader with excellent people skills and a flair for motivating and developing others.
Someone who's strategic, creative, and can juggle multiple priorities while delivering high-quality work.
A strong understanding of the media landscape and the ability to advise on reputational risk and opportunity.
What you'll get in return:
A rewarding role where your work has real community impact.
A supportive, flexible working environment including hybrid working.
Opportunities for professional development.
The chance to lead on exciting campaigns and high-visibility projects across the organisation.
This is a politically restricted post under the Local Government and Housing Act 1989. Occasional evening and weekend work will be required to support events and media activity.

Disability Confident
A Disability Confident employer will generally offer an interview to any applicant that declares they have a disability and meets the minimum criteria for the job as defined by the employer. It is important to note that in certain recruitment situations such as high-volume, seasonal and high-peak times, the employer may wish to limit the overall numbers of interviews offered to both disabled people and non-disabled people.
